onejayhawk Posted December 17, 2020 Share Posted December 17, 2020 18 hours ago, incognito_man said: Probably. Rodgers has faced the 20th rated schedule. Mahomes has faced the 29th rated schedule. So far. I don't know where you get your rankings, but the one I saw was a lot closer. GB #27, KC #30. This is before the Chiefs play the #2 ranked Saints. http://www.powerrankingsguru.com/nfl/strength-of-schedule.php The major flaw in these is that the good teams drive down their own schedule. Hence KC #30 and Denver #3, despite having 3/4 of the schedule the same. J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
